
Sinulog Festival Strikes Cebu City 2012
by Jhaypee Guia on October 23, 2012One of the happiest and grandest festivals in the country again celebrated in Cebu City, the Sinulog Festival. It is a very famous event held every 3rd week of Sunday in the month of January in honor of Santo Niño, the child Jesus and the patron saint of Cebu. It commemorates the Bisayan people's pagan origin, and their acceptance of Roman Catholicism.

Cebu Country Club
by Jane Dacumos on September 24, 2012The Cebu Country Club is a golf and country club resort complex that features a par 71, 18-hole championship golf course, landscaped terrain, gardens, and villas furnished with ground coral rock. Since its establishment in 1928, it has become an exclusive private club in Cebu City.
